Thursday, March 08, 2007- Almost 60 people showed up Saturday to help clear about five tons of rocks from Oak Island beaches during the Rock’N Party.

Rocks still litter the beaches, and another rock
picking is scheduled for April 14, probably in the
morning. No experience is necessary to help the
Oak Island Beach Preservation Society’s ongoing
effort to make the beach rock-free. Tons of rocks
appeared on the beaches during a sand nourishment
project about five years ago.
